Carolina Crab Boil

Total Time

Prep: 15 min. Cook: 35 min.

Makes

4 servings

Updated: Sep. 30, 2022
This pot is a fun way to feed a crowd for a tailgate. You can serve it two ways: Drain the cooking liquid and pour out the pot on a paper-lined table so folks can dig in, or serve it as a stew in its liquid over hot rice. —Melissa Pelkey Hass, Waleska, Georgia

Ingredients

  • 2 teaspoons canola oil
  • 1 package (14 ounces) smoked turkey sausage, cut into 1/2-inch slices
  • 2 cartons (32 ounces each) reduced-sodium chicken broth
  • 4 cups water
  • 1 bottle (12 ounces) light beer or 1-1/2 cups additional reduced-sodium chicken broth
  • 1/4 cup seafood seasoning
  • 5 bay leaves
  • 4 medium ears sweet corn, cut into 2-inch pieces
  • 1 pound fingerling potatoes
  • 1 medium red onion, quartered
  • 2 pounds cooked snow crab legs
  • Pepper to taste

Directions

  1. In a stockpot, heat oil over medium-high heat; brown sausage. Stir in broth, water, beer, seafood seasoning and bay leaves. Add vegetables; b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, 20-25 minutes or until potatoes are tender.
  2. Add crab; heat through. Drain; remove bay leaves. Transfer to a serving bowl; season with pepper.
